"Imitation is suicide."
GaryK [48]
The line "Imitation is suicide" from Ralph Waldo Emerson's "Self-Reliance" uses the rhetorical device metaphor. The correct answer is option C. Metaphor is a figure of speech that is used to convey an implied comparison between two different objects. In this line, the word "imitation" is compared to "suicide".
